Wiesn 2024 live stream: How to follow the Oktoberfest on screen

The television station münchen.tv reports live from the Oktoberfest for around three hours every day from 6:20 p.m. If you can't get the local station, you can also stream it online. In addition to the TV broadcast, there are a few live cams on the festival grounds that you can use to follow the Oktoberfest events on the internet. When the Oktoberfest is on hiatus, you will usually find a short “best of” video from the previous Oktoberfest among the live cams from the festival grounds and the tents.
